  10. On 2/5/2023 at 4:54 PM, Germanshepherd said:

    There’s a good idea somewhere in here, but this ain’t it. Flag football is really boring. 

    I figure that, at least for the spectator, might be chalked up to the fact that flag and tackle may use the same ball, but tend to be so different that strategies that work in flag tend to not work in tackle, and vice versa.  What I mean by this is that while flag rulesets universally substitute flag pulls for tackling, few of them substitute anything for the act of blocking, and consequently, unlike tackle, there are no dedicated linemen.  Ergo, flag strategies tend to look like there are too many moving parts.
